Who is the Hammerstein Ballroom named after?

History. The Manhattan Center was constructed in 1906 by Oscar Hammerstein I as the Manhattan Opera House, the home for his Manhattan Opera Company, an alternative to the popular yet comparatively expensive Metropolitan Opera.

What are the best seats at Hammerstein Ballroom?

Hammerstein Ballroom Seating Chart: The Best Seats In our experience, getting First Balcony seats are your best bet. We say this because the venue will sell 1,000-2,000 Floor GA tickets and to get close to the stage is near impossible. Depending on the event will dictate how many people they stuff in there.

How old is the Hammerstein Ballroom?

Hammerstein Ballroom is part of the Manhattan Center complex. The Hammerstein Ballroom, opened in 1906 by Oscar Hammerstein I, is a two-tiered ballroom located within the Manhattan Center Studios. From 1910, the venue was used for a variety of events aside from Opera, including Vaudeville.
